What does a game producer do?

A Game Producer oversees the development process of a video game from concept to release. They coordinate the work of different teams, manage budgets and timelines, and ensure that the game meets quality standards and project goals. Producers serve as a bridge between developers, artists, designers, and stakeholders, solving problems and keeping the project on track. Their role is crucial in ensuring that the vision for the game is realized while staying within scope and schedule.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a game producer?

To thrive as a Game Producer, you need strong project management skills, a solid understanding of game development processes, and often a degree in game design, computer science, or a related field. Familiarity with project management tools (like Jira or Trello), version control systems, and sometimes Agile or Scrum certification is highly valued.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ving abilities help producers coordinate teams and navigate challenges. These skills are crucial for ensuring games are delivered on time, within budget, and to a high standard of quality.

How does a game producer typically collaborate with development, art, and QA teams during a project?

Game Producers serve as the central point of coordination between development, art, and QA teams. They facilitate communication by organizing regular meetings, tracking progress, and ensuring that each team’s deliverables align with the project milestones. Producers also help resolve cross-team challenges, adjust timelines as needed, and balance creative vision with resource constraints. Their collaborative approach helps keep the project on schedule and ensures that quality standards are met throughout the development cycle.

Position Summary


We are seeking an experienced Producer to join our Game Development team in Las Vegas.

The Producer serves as the operational owner of multiple game development projects, partnering with Game Design, Engineering, Art, Animation, QA, Compliance, and Product teams to deliver high-quality games from concept through release.

This role is responsible for driving execution across multiple cross-functional teams by building schedules, managing priorities, identifying risks early, removing blockers, and ensuring projects remain aligned with business objectives. Successful Producers are highly organized communicators who thrive in fast-paced environments and enjoy bringing people together to solve complex problems.



Primary Roles and Responsibilities

  • Own the day-to-day production of multiple concurrent game development projects.
  • Build and maintain project schedules, timelines, and production roadmaps.
  • Partner with cross-functional teams to establish realistic milestones and delivery plans.
  • Proactively identify project risks, dependencies, and resource constraints, developing mitigation plans before issues impact delivery.
  • Facilitate effective communication between Engineering, Art, Animation, QA, Game Design, Product Management, and studio leadership.
  • Track project health through regular status reporting, ensuring stakeholders have clear visibility into progress, risks, and upcoming milestones.
  • Coordinate project planning activities including sprint planning, milestone reviews, and release readiness.
  • Drive accountability across project teams while fostering a collaborative, solutions-focused environment.
  • Continuously evaluate production processes and recommend improvements that increase efficiency, predictability, and quality.
  • Support studio-wide initiatives that improve development workflows, tooling, and production standards.
Requirements:

Experience and Education

  • 3+ years of experience in Game Production, Project Management, Technical Production, or a similar role.
  • Experience managing multiple concurrent projects with cross-functional teams.
  • Strong organizational, planning, and prioritization sk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to identify risks, manage competing priorities, and drive projects to completion.
  • Experience with project management tools such as Jira, Confluence, or similar platforms.
  • Strong problem-solving skills with a proactive, ownership-oriented mindset.
  • Experience working with casino gaming or slots is a plus
  • Bachelor's degree in Business, Game Development, Computer Science, or a related field, or equivalent professional experience is a plus

What Success Looks Like

  • Games are delivered predictably with clear visibility into schedule, scope, and risk.
  • Cross-functional teams remain aligned and informed throughout development.
  • Risks are identified and addressed before they impact production.
  • Production processes continuously improve, enabling teams to deliver high-quality games efficiently.
  • Team members feel supported, organized, and empowered to do their best work.
